CARACAS, Venezuela (AP) — A former Green Beret has taken responsibility for what he claimed was a failed attack Sunday aimed at overthrowing Venezuelan President Nicolás Maduro and that the socialist government said ended with eight dead.
Jordan Goudreau’s comments in an interview with an exiled Venezuelan journalist capped a bizarre day that started with reports of a predawn amphibious raid near the South American country’s heavily guarded capital.
An AP investigation published Friday found that Goudreau had been working with a retired Venezuelan army general now facing U.S. narcotics charges to train dozens of deserters from Venezuela’s security forces at secret camps inside neighboring Colombia. The goal was to mount a cross-border raid that would end in Maduro’s arrest.

A doctor in the Paris region says one of his patients who was diagnosed with pneumonia in December was, in fact, infected with Covid-19. The report, which is due to be published in detail this week, would make it the first known case of the disease in France – a month earlier than previously thought.

THE HAGUE, Netherlands (AP) — All it took was a few sturdy swings with a sledgehammer and a prized painting by Vincent van Gogh was gone.
A Dutch crime-busting television show has aired security camera footage showing how an art thief smashed his way through reinforced glass doors at a museum in the early hours of March 30. He later hurried out through the museum gift shop with a Vincent van Gogh painting tucked under his right arm and the sledgehammer in his left hand.
Police hope that publicizing the images will help them track down the thief who stole Van Gogh’s “The Parsonage Garden at Nuenen in Spring 1884” from the Singer Laren Museum while it was shut down due to coronavirus containment measures.

Event 201 was a 3.5-hour pandemic tabletop exercise that simulated a series of dramatic, scenario-based facilitated discussions, confronting difficult, true-to-life dilemmas associated with response to a hypothetical, but scientifically plausible, pandemic. 15 global business, government, and public health leaders were players in the simulation exercise that highlighted unresolved real-world policy and economic issues that could be solved with sufficient political will, financial investment, and attention now and in the future.
The exercise consisted of pre-recorded news broadcasts, live “staff” briefings, and moderated discussions on specific topics. These issues were carefully designed in a compelling narrative that educated the participants and the audience.
The Johns Hopkins Center for Health Security, World Economic Forum, and Bill & Melinda Gates Foundation jointly propose these recommendations.
VTT researchers have successfully demonstrated a new electronic refrigeration technology that could enable major leaps in the development of quantum computers. Present quantum computers require extremely complicated and large cooling infrastructure that is based on mixture of isotopes of helium. The new electronic cooling technology could replace these cryogenic liquid mixtures and enable miniaturization of quantum computers.
In this purely electrical refrigeration method, cooling and thermal isolation operate effectively through the same point like junction. In the experiment the researchers suspended a piece of silicon from such junctions and refrigerated the object by feeding electrical current from one junction to another through the piece. The current lowered the thermodynamic temperature of the silicon object as much as 40% from that of the surroundings. This could lead to the miniaturization of future quantum computers, as it can simplify the required cooling infrastructure significantly. The discovery has been published in Science Advances.
“We expect that this newly discovered electronic cooling method could be used in several applications from the miniaturization of quantum computers to ultra-sensitive radiation sensors of the security field,” says Research Professor Mika Prunnila from VTT Technical Research Centre of Finland.
Google Chrome has dominated the internet browser market for the last decade with a staggering near-60% market share and users stretching into the billions.
Rivals to Google Chrome, including Apple’s Safari, Microsoft’s Edge (formerly known as Internet Explorer), and Mozilla’s Firefox have largely failed to convince users to switch—but browser choices are becoming more complex.
Users’ desire for greater security, better privacy, and an ill-defined need to “take back control” from the likes of Google and Microsoft has opened the door for alternatives—including blockchain-based privacy browser Brave, whose chief executive thinks Google “is going to be taken apart over coming years.”
